MINIMUM BIDS

Each lot in the auction has a Minimum Bid (designated in the printed catalogue and online as "MB"). Some lots in the sale also have a reserve price. A reserve price is the confidential minimum amount below which the consignor of the lot will not sell the property. Therefore an amount equal to or in excess of the reserve must be bid on a lot in order for a successful bid to be accepted on that lot. We may implement such reserve by bidding on behalf of the Consignor and may bid up to the amount of the reserve, by placing successive or consecutive bids for a lot, or bids in response to other bidders. In instances where we have an interest in the lot other than our commission, we may bid up to the reserve to protect such interest. Most lots in the sale do not have a reserve. Unless an item is withdrawn from the sale, for all items in the sale without reserves, the lots will be sold to the highest bidder at or above the Minimum Bid price or any amount higher than the Minimum Bids.

BIDDING INCREMENTS – INCREMENTAL BIDS AND MAXIMUM BIDS

When bidding, you will be able to view the current high bid for each lot. When you want to bid, you will click through to the individual lot page. There you will be able to view a pull-down menu of incremental bid amounts. You will have the option of selecting the next incremental bid (the lowest amount that the pull-down menu displays) or any bid higher than the next incremental bid (a Maximum Bid). If you select a Maximum Bid, the auction program will bid incrementally on your behalf one bid at a time up to but not exceeding your "maximum" bid amount with the intention of winning the item at the lowest possible price. Bid increments are 10%. In the event that two or more bidders place the same Maximum Bid, and that bid remains the highest bid following the closing of that lot, then the earliest received bid will be recognized as the successful and winning bid.

EXTENDED BIDDING PERIOD

The Extended Bidding Period will apply to all lots that have received two or more bids above the Minimum Bid during the Initial Bidding Period. The Extended Bidding Period will last for two hours beginning at 6:00PM PST (9:00PM EST) and ending at 8:00 PST (11:00PM EST) on Thursday, July 23rd. You are only eligible to bid on items during the Extended Bidding Period (and the Closing Bidding Period) if you have placed a bid on that item prior to 6:00PM PST (9:00PM EST) on Thursday, July 23rd.

CLOSING BIDDING PERIOD – THE 30 MINUTE RULE

The Closing Period will begin when the Extended Bidding Period ends at 8:00PM PST (11:00PM EST) on Thursday, July 23rd. Each lot will then close individually during the Closing Bidding Period after that specific lot has not received a bid for 30 minutes. NOTE: The whole auction will NOT close at one time. When a bid is placed on a lot during the Closing Period, the clock (countdown to lot closing) will re-set back to 30 minutes on that lot only. During the Closing Bidding Period, you will be able to view the amount of time left before each lot will close. On the main auction pages (those listing multiple lots, e.g., Lots 1-20), you will be able to view the approximate number of minutes left before each lot will close. The individual lot pages and the My Bids pages are the best areas to view the time remaining before each lot closes. Click the "Refresh Button" in your browser to make sure you are viewing the most up-to-date information during the Closing Bidding Period. After 30 minutes has elapsed during the Closing Bidding Period without a bid on a given lot, then that lot will "close" and the winning bidder will be declared. REMEMBER: Each lot closes on an individual basis per THE 30 MINUTE RULE. In order to bid on a lot during the Extended and Closing Bidding Periods, you must have placed an initial bid on that lot prior to the end of the Initial Bidding Period (between 10:00AM PST on Wednesday, July 8th and 6:00PM PST on Thursday, July 23rd).

For example, during the Closing Bidding Period, if a new bid is placed on a lot at 8:15PM PST, then the 30 minute closing clock is re-set and the earliest that lot may close becomes 8:45PM PST. If there are no more bids on that lot after the 8:15PM PST bid, then that lot will close at 8:45PM PST, which is equal to 30 minutes elapsing without a bid being placed on that lot. If you are a current high bidder on a lot during the Closing Bidding Period, and you change your "Maximum Bid," the amount of time before the lot closes will not change and will remain the same. Only a bid placed by another bidder will re-set the 30 minute closing clock.

HAMMER PRICE AND THE BUYER’S PREMIUM

The bid amounts placed in this sale at www.scpauctions.com are sometimes also referred to as the hammer prices. A Buyer’s Premium will be added to the winning bid or hammer price and is payable by the purchaser as part of the total purchase price. The Buyer’s Premium is equal to 20% of the winning bid price. As an example, in the event that you win a lot with a successful bid price (hammer price) of $1,000, then your total cost for that lot will be equal to the $1,000 successful bid price plus the 20% Buyer’s Premium. In this example, the total cost for that lot will equal $1,200 (plus shipping, handling, insurance, and California sales tax if applicable).

NEW SCP AUCTIONS PSA/DNA AUTOGRAPH AUTHENTICATION POLICY

SCP Auctions is committed, with respect to signed material, to selling only items that have been reviewed and authenticated by PSA/DNA, JSA and in some instances Upper Deck Authenticated. Recent policy changes initiated by PSA/DNA have resulted in SCP Auctions no longer issuing auction letters to serve as letters of authenticity (LOA’s). Instead, PSA/DNA will now issue full letters of authenticity (LOA’s) for specific items in our catalog. All other items will be "Pre-Certified" upon being deemed authentic by PSA/DNA. A PSA/DNA lot is one that has been reviewed by PSA/DNA autograph experts. Please note that it is the responsibility of the bidder to review the information provided for each lot in order to determine what form of authentication will accompany each item. Winning bidders may submit their "Pre-Certified" items to PSA/DNA within 60 days of the auction closing with their invoice or proof of purchase from our auction house to receive special pricing from PSA/DNA on upgrades to full letters of authentication (LOA’s). Please visit www.psadna.com for further rules and instructions.
